A "BDRip" means the video was encoded directly from a retail Blu-ray Disc source. Unlike a "BRRip" (which is an encode of an already compressed release), a BDRip typically yielded much better visual fidelity because the encoder worked directly with the raw, high-bitrate master files from the disc. 3.
